Cross Purpose heralds the arrival of a distinctive new voice, debut novelist Claire MacLeary. When Maggie Laird's disgraced husband, an ex cop, dies unexpectedly, her life is turned upside down. To pay off debts she takes on his struggling detective agency, enlisting the help of her neighbour, 'Big Wilma’. The discovery of a mutilated body draws them into the unknown world of Aberdeen's sink estates, clandestine childminding and dodgy dealers. Gritty and funny, Cross Purpose is also a paean to friendship, demonstrating how women of a “certain age” can defy the odds.
Acclaimed author Clio Gray’s exciting new Scottish Mystery Trilogy begins with Deadly Prospects. It’s set in Sutherland, in 1869, when a big corporation rolls into town determined to reopen its mine and reinvigorate the harsh conditions in this remote Highland enclave. When a body is found next to some strange inscriptions, things take a sinister turn. Grey’s previous historical thrillers were bestsellers. The Anatomist’s Dream, was nominated for the Man Booker prize in 2015, and long-listed for the Bailey’s Prize in 2016.
